View.HasExplicitFocusable プロパティ

定義

このビューがフォーカス可能な場合、または を返す到達可能なビューが含まれている場合は #hasExplicitFocusable() true を返します true

public virtual bool HasExplicitFocusable { [Android.Runtime.Register("hasExplicitFocusable", "()Z", "GetHasExplicitFocusableHandler", ApiSince=26)] get; }
[<get: Android.Runtime.Register("hasExplicitFocusable", "()Z", "GetHasExplicitFocusableHandler", ApiSince=26)>]
member this.HasExplicitFocusable : bool

プロパティ値

true ビューがフォーカス可能な場合、またはビューにフォーカス可能なビューが含まれている場合は 、 false それ以外の場合は

属性

注釈

このビューがフォーカス可能な場合、または を返す到達可能なビューが含まれている場合は #hasExplicitFocusable() true を返します true。 "reachable hasExplicitFocusable()" は、親が子孫のフォーカスをブロックしないビューです。 が返#FOCUSABLEされる#getFocusable()ビューのみが#VISIBLEフォーカス可能と見なされます。

このメソッドは、明示的にフォーカス可能に設定されたビューのみが true を返すという点で、 の事前Build.VERSION_CODES#O 動作 #hasFocusable() を保持します。 フォーカス可能に解決される に #FOCUSABLE_AUTO 設定されたビューは設定されません。

の Java ドキュメント android.view.View.hasExplicitFocusable()

このページの一部は、によって作成および共有され、に記載されている条件に従って使用される作業に基づく変更です。

適用対象